Housing caucus, staff and governor credited with shaping investments

Speakers credited a housing caucus, legislative staff and Governor Michelle Lujan Grisham with shaping housing legislation and future investment rounds, and thanked staff for their role in crafting impactful measures.

A lawmaker acknowledged the work of speaker staff and caucus staff, saying "we have a housing caucus where our democratic leaders are meeting" to discuss legislation that would be most impactful for the next session. The speaker thanked staff and caucus members for their role in shaping proposals.

Another lawmaker specifically thanked Governor Michelle Lujan Grisham for her continuing role in shaping investment rounds that support New Mexicans. The remarks linked legislative caucus activity with executive support as complementary forces in advancing housing assistance.
